About A Gente se Vira

Founded in 2013 by locals from Tijuca, Rio de Janeiro, the "A Gente se Vira" bloco (street band) exudes excitement and interaction with the audience. Its proposal is to play mainly samba-enredo (theme song samba), with influences from funk and axé.

The bloco holds regular rehearsals at the Unidos da Tijuca samba school court and participates in important events such as "Bloco na Rua" and "Carnaval da Diversidade" (Diversity Carnival).
